Hans,

I have the same feeling about this... while we all would like to see a
community like it exists for Linux, C, ... we won't get it by just dumping
sources to the outside world.  The reason is that most of us don't have an
environment (and if they do, it is at the office where they don't have the
time) to play with it, nor to develop it on.

In my opinion, it is not the amount of available source that is driving the
popularity, but rather the access to a machine to play with during your free
time.  This is still the biggest problem (I don't see much people sharing
code that has been written during office hours).

If IBM would make it possible to run OS/400 on an Intel platform... we would
have a completely different picture !
